Facilities ticket — Night shift, Brindlecote Campus. Twenty-two interns from the Fennhollow programme arrive tomorrow at 08:00. Please unlock seminar rooms B2 and B3 by 06:30, set chairs to classroom layout, and confirm the water coolers on level one are refilled. Leave the loading bay clear for their equipment van. Overnight access to the prep corridor requires the pass code below.

badge for bajop-yawep: bdg-NNHEW-6

Security review requested. The Bouncewright email bounce processor in prod-east no longer matches the baseline committed to the Marrowline repo. Retry ceilings, DSN parsing flags, and the quarantine toggle were all changed manually during the Fenholt incident and never reverted. Staging still runs the approved values, so behavior diverges across environments. No change record exists for the edits. Please assess whether the live values weaken suppression-list handling. Current live configuration as dumped from the running service follows.

deployment values, tafof-taduf:
pelius:
  pin: 6508
  tenant: praiel
  seal: seal_4e33a2f4
  metrics_host: metrics.pelius.plorvagrid.corp
  standby_team: druix
  escalation: juldor-norius
  nonce: 5db598

# Quornbeck Relay — broker upgrade notes for plugin authors.
# We moved from Relay 3.x to Relay 4 (the "Fennwick" line).
# Breaking changes: queue names are now namespaced per plugin,
# heartbeat interval dropped to 10s, and the legacy STOMP shim is gone.
# Rebuild plugins against the v4 SDK before connecting; v3 clients
# will be refused at handshake.
# Declare your plugin namespace via QB_PLUGIN_NS below.
# The broker now requires an auth credential on every connection,
# so the next line sets it:

env line for fafof-fahag: LEDGER_TOKEN5=f8790

Finance Review Summary — Board Only

We have completed review of the term sheet from Bryllhaven Capital regarding the proposed Quartermile joint venture. Valuation assumptions appear defensible, though the liquidation preference warrants negotiation. Counsel flagged two clauses on exclusivity. Our recommendation is conditional acceptance pending revisions. The confidential strategic context for this partnership is set out below.

internal memo for kawip-hadug: Headcount on the Wenwyn team goes from 7 to 140 by the end of January. Gross margin on Wenwyn came in at 20 percent against a plan of 15 percent.